The deputy asked the speaker to discuss the problems of Kyrgyz citizens in Russia with Volodin and Matviyenko.
Dastan Jumabekov, in his speech, emphasized that Kyrgyz citizens working in Russia in the field of entrepreneurship face numerous difficulties.
He noted: "Restrictions have also affected workers in the textile industry; goods worth millions of dollars that are at the border cannot be imported or returned. I urge you to reach out to Vyacheslav Volodin, Chairman of the State Duma, and Valentina Matviyenko, Chairwoman of the Federation Council, to initiate a trip to Russia to discuss this situation. Citizens regularly file complaints, and the parliament must take measures to address these issues," the deputy addressed the speaker.
Turgunbek uulu responded that he received an official invitation from Matviyenko and Volodin, and the visit is expected to take place in the third decade of March.
"These important issues will certainly be addressed," the speaker added.
